Sony’s latest Android tablet features a 1.5 GHz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 processor and a 1920 x 1200 pixel display. The Sony Xperia Tablet Z also packs 2GB of RAM and 32GB of storage, and an 8MP camera.
In other words, it’s a pretty big upgrade over the Sony Xperia Tablet S, which the company launched less than half a year ago.
Sony Xperia Tablet Z
The new tablet also features a waterproof and dustproof case, a microSD card slot for extra storage, NFC, and support for 4G LTE.
The Android 4.1 tablet measures just 0.27 inches thick and weighs 1.1 pounds. Unlike Sony’s earlier Android tablets, which had 9.4 inch screen, the Xperia Table Z has a 10.1 inch display, which makes the size and weight even more impressive.
Sony hasn’t yet announced the price or release date for the new tablet, but with the Xperia Tablet S still selling for about $400 even though it has a slower processor, less memory, and a lower resolution display, I wouldn’t expect the Sony Xperia Tablet Z to be a low-cost tablet.

The HTC Butterfly was first announced in Japan as the Butterfly J and in US as Droid DNA. Running on Android 4.1 Jelly Bean, it is equipped with a 5-inch 1080p Super LCD 3 display and powered by a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 chipset which features a quad-core 1.5GHz Krait CPU and Adreno 320 GPU. Other features included in it are 2GB of RAM, 16GB internal storage, 8-megapixels main camera, 2.2-megapixels wide angle front-facing camera, Beats Audio enhancements and 2020mAh non-removable battery.

Just days after the latest Google Nexus products hit the streets, a couple of repair shops have taken apart the Nexus 4 smartphone and Nexus 10 tablet to see what lies beneath the surface. And they’ve posted teardown guides online.
iFixit Google Nexus 4 teardown
Nexus 4 secrets
The Google Nexus 4 features a 4.7 inch screen, a quad-core processor, 2GB of RAM, an 8MP rear camera, 1.3MP front camera, WiFi, Bluetooth, GPS, NFC, and HSPA+.
But iFixit found something else hidden in the case: a 4G LTE chip.
The Nexus 4 has taken a fair share of criticism for not supporting LTE, but it looks like manufacturer LG actually left in the same wireless chip used in its Optimus G smartphone. Unfortunately it may not be connected to an antenna or power amplifier, so it’d take more than a software update to enable LTE.
Overall, iFixit gives the device a fairly high repairability score since it’s not that difficult to disassemble. But replacing the battery or screen will be more difficult than on some other phones.

The Google Nexus 4 is a phone with a Qualcomm Snapdragon quad-core processor, a 4.7 inch, 1280 x 768 pixel display, 2GB of RAM, up to 16GB of storage, and Android 4.2 software. It’s built by LG, and prices start at $299 for a model with 8GB of storage.
Google’s Nexus 10 tablet features a 10 inch, 2560 x 1600 pixel display, 2GB of RAM, and a dual core Samsung Exynos 5250 ARM Cortex-A15 processor. It’s manufactured by Samsung, and prices start at $399 for a 16GB model.

Sony will not be happy about this at all, but pictures of the Sony C660X (C6603) handset (codenamed Yuga) have leaked. There are seven pictures in total and everything we have been told by our sources up until now, suggest that these pictures are the real deal.
The site that has leaked the pictures, Android Schweiz, claims Yuga will come with a 1.5GHz quad-core processor, 2GB RAM, a surprising 12MP camera (we always thought 13MP Exmor RS was pretty much a dead cert) and a 5-inch 1080p display. The camera may be upgraded by the time it comes to launch though. 
The Yuga comes in a unibody enclosure, therefore do not expect to be able to replace the battery. It will also be the first Sony Xperia phone to come with a glass back, similar to the iPhone 4/4S. The handset design looks elegant with a boxy shape (no arc or NXT features here) and a very thin bezel either side of the display. It has a striking chrome power button on the right side with volume rocker in the middle. A dedicated camera button is also present where you’d expect it to be.
As can be seen in the pictures below, this prototype is running Android 4.1.1, a new kernel version (3.4) as well as 10.1.A.0.XXX firmware, which we already know is Jelly Bean. It all looks like a very nice package indeed and we can’t wait to see/hear more. So, would you buy it?

Chinese smartphone manufacturer Oppo Mobile has something amazing in the making. The company’s CEO Chen Mingyong teased the Oppo Find 5 quad-core flagship with 1080p display, sporting the mind-blowing pixel density of 441ppi.


Such pixel density puts the upcoming 5" device in an entirely different league from the current crop of top shelf smartphones. A 441ppi pixel density is roughly100ppi better than the next best smartphone and a cool 115ppi better than the Apple iPhone 5.
The rest of the Oppo Find 5 rumored specs include a quad-core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 Pro chipset, 2GB of RAM, 12MP camera, Android 4.1 Jelly Bean, and a 2500mAh battery.

With IFA only a few days away, the LG E973 Optimus G has emerged in leaked photos. One of the likely stars of the shows looks bound to claim the title of the best equipped device in the Android realm.
   
The LG E973 Optimus G packs a killer spec sheet, which includes a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 Pro chipset with four 1.5 GHz CPU cores, 2GB of RAM, and Adreno 320 GPU. The display is LG's own 4.7" IPS HD unit with HD (1280 x 720 pixels) resolution and pixel density of 320ppi. A 13MP camera is located on the back of the handset. The OS of the pre-production unit in the leaked photos is Android 4.0 ICS.
Unsurprisingly, the report claims that the smartphone is blazing fast thanks to its top of the line hardware. However, there might be some improvements to the hardware before the device's official announcement, including an update to Android 4.1 Jelly Bean.

The design of the Xiaomi M2 was something I was personally worried about. We had rumors and photos suggest odd 2 tone phones, and designs which looked just like the Xiaomi M1 (which have actually turned out to be the Xiaomi M1s).
Thankfully though Beijing based Xiaomi have done us proud and wrapped the world’s fastest quad-core Android phone up in an extremely handsome body.
Fans of Chinese phones will already be pointing out the similarities between the M2 and Meizu’s 4-core MX, but rest assured that although the 2 phones look similar they are completely different beasts!
The Xiaomi M2 measures in at 126mm x 62mm x 10.2mm and weighs in at 145g. So while the M2 isn’t the thinnest or lightest Android phone on the planet it s certainly no porker either, and it very much is the fastest!
Like the Meizu MX the rear of the new Xiaomi phone is a glossy white plastic with an 8 mega-pixel rear camera sitting in the center with LED flash for night photos and a small speaker grill which should aid audio while capturing video.
The front of the Xiaomi M2 though is distinctly Xiaomi in design meaning there are no physical buttons on the face (there is a physical volume rocker and camera shutter button along the edge though).
Also new for Xiaomi is the front camera which is located in the top right hand corner above the screen (more on the cameras below).

xiaomi m2 performance 237x300 Xiaomi M2 launched today! Here is everything you need to know!Xiaomi M2 performance

We already knew the Xiaomi M2 was going to be one powerful device as we had already seen these leaked benchmarks, but it was nice of Xiaomi to confirm our suspicions today.
The Xiaomi M2 is now officially the world’s fastest quad-core phone, which is pretty impressive for a company only on their 2nd device, and for a phone which only costs $313 (1999 Yuan)!
What’s giving the Xiaomi M2 it’s world class level of speed and performance is a combination of both hardware and software.
The CPU is a Qualcomm Snapdraggon 8064 CPU quad-core chip clocked at 1.5ghz, so it is like 2 of the original Xiaomi’s strapped together and then attached to a ballistic missile when it comes to processing power!
To prevent any lack of memory to the powerful CPU, Xiaomi have been extremely generous and have given the M2 a full 2GB RAM and 16GB ROM.
This all adds up to a quad-core phone which is hugely powerful and capable of leaving other top of the range quad-core devices such as the HTC One X and Samsung Galaxy S3 spitting dust!
With all this power on tap you would be right in thinking the Xiaomi M2 will make for a very capable gaming phone with some who have tested the phone and are familiar with all the hardware suggesting the M2 is on par with the Xbox 360 thanks to the Adreno 320 graphics chip.

xiaomi m2 cameras 237x300 Xiaomi M2 launched today! Here is everything you need to know!Xiaomi M2 Cameras

The M2 has 2 cameras this time which means you can take photos of your friends and also nice photos of yourself posing. In fact Xiaomi have really gone to town with the front camera which is a 2 mega-pixel unit capable of capturing 1080p HD video!
The rear camera on the M2 is also able to capture 1080 HD video, but is a much more capable 8 mega-pixel unit. While some might feel that 8 mega-pixel camera’s are a little last generation, Xiaomi have gone to great lengths to ensure the M2’s camera is the cream-de-la-cream of camera phones.
One of the highlights of the rear camera is that it features an f 2.0 apperture and is capable of shooting video at 90fps! The lens has also been improved to give better wide-angle ability.
According to those at the event the photos from the Xiaomi M2’s rear camera are absolutely stunning!

xiaomi m2 screen 234x300 Xiaomi M2 launched today! Here is everything you need to know!Xiaomi M2 Screen

Not content with producing the fastest quad-core Android phone, Xiaomi have decided to give the M2 a very impressive 4.3 inch display!
How impressive? Well according to the specifications the screen on the M2 is much better than the retina display used in the current iPhone 4S and boasts a resolution of 1280 x 720 and 342PPI.
